# Evidence Chain Contract The evidence chain contract fixes the MVP relationship between L1 audit records and L4 agent or worker evidence without changing either implementation surface. It is a fixture-level contract for now: services may persist the records in their existing tables, while the chain example binds the identities that must not split later. ## Minimal ID Relationship Every MVP evidence chain has one `operationId`, one `traceId`, one or more `auditId` values, and one or more `evidenceId` values. - `operationId` is the workflow anchor. It must match the `hardwareOperation.operationId`, every chain `auditEvents[].operationId`, every `traceEvents[].operationId`, and every `evidenceRecords[].operationId`. - `traceId` is the request and execution correlation ID. It must match every `auditEvents[].traceId` and every `traceEvents[].traceId`. Because the L0 `evidence-record` schema does not carry `traceId` at the top level, MVP evidence records must copy it to `evidenceRecords[].metadata.traceId`. - `auditId` is unique per audit event in a chain. Each evidence record must set `metadata.producedByAuditId` to an audit event in the same fixture. The audit event that records evidence must target that evidence record with `targetType: "evidence_record"` and `targetId: `. - `evidenceId` is the stable artifact record ID. It must be unique in a chain, belong to the same `projectId`, `operationId`, and `environment`, and point to a content-addressed artifact through `uri`, `sha256`, and optional `sizeBytes`. The same relationship applies whether the producer is a hardware trusted loop or an agent automation loop. Agent and worker IDs are optional for hardware-only chains, but when present they must be carried consistently by the operation, trace events, and evidence records. ## MVP Required Fields The fixture root is not a database table. It exists to verify cross-record relationships and must include: - `chainId` - `schemaVersion` - `scenario` - `projectId` - `operationId` - `traceId` - `environment` - `hardwareOperation` - `auditEvents` - `traceEvents` - `evidenceRecords` `hardwareOperation` must satisfy the L0 hardware operation required fields: `operationId`, `projectId`, `gatewaySessionId`, `resourceId`, `capabilityId`, `requestedBy`, `status`, `environment`, `requestedAt`, and `updatedAt`. Each MVP `auditEvents[]` entry must satisfy the L0 audit event required fields and additionally include `projectId`, `operationId`, and `outcome` so the audit stream can be joined back to the operation without service-specific inference. Each MVP `traceEvents[]` entry must satisfy the L0 trace event required fields and additionally include `operationId`. Each MVP `evidenceRecords[]` entry must satisfy the L0 evidence record required fields and additionally include: - `metadata.traceId` - `metadata.producedByAuditId` Agent automation chains must also include `agentSessionId` and `workerSessionId` at the fixture root, on the hardware operation, on trace events, and on evidence records. ## Future Enhancements The first version intentionally avoids heavier guarantees. Later contracts may add: - canonical chain hashing, previous-record links, and signatures - attestation data from real hardware roots of trust - retention policy, storage tier, and artifact redaction metadata - richer OpenTelemetry or JSON-LD correlation fields - multiple operations under one trace with explicit parent-child edges - policy decision records for agent authorization and remediation Those additions must preserve the MVP identity bindings above. ## Fixtures The MVP fixture set lives under `protocol/examples/evidence-chain`: - `fixtures/hardware-trusted-loop.json` - `fixtures/agent-automation-loop.json` - `artifacts/hardware-trusted-measurement.json` - `artifacts/agent-automation-report.json` Validate the examples with: ```sh node scripts/validate-evidence-chain.mjs ```
